优草派 > 问答 > 视觉设计

excel中批量将经纬度度分秒转换成十进制小数点的方法介绍?

作者:tangjs0419     

在现代的地理信息系统中,经纬度是地球表面的坐标系,经常被用于表示一个地点的位置。在excel中,经纬度通常以度分秒的形式存储,但是在某些情况下,我们需要将其转换成十进制小数点形式进行计算和分析。本文将介绍如何在excel中批量将经纬度度分秒转换成十进制小数点的方法。一、基础知识

在将经纬度度分秒转换成十进制小数点之前,我们需要了解一些基础知识。

1. 经度和纬度

经度是指一个地点距离本初子午线的角度,通常用E或W表示。例如,上海的经度为E121°28'52"。

纬度是指一个地点距离地球赤道的角度,通常用N或S表示。例如,上海的纬度为N31°14'51"。

2. 度分秒和十进制小数点

度分秒是将一个角度表示为度、分、秒的方式,通常用符号°、'、''表示。例如,上海的经度为121度28分52秒,可以表示为E121°28'52"。

十进制小数点是将一个角度表示为小数的方式,通常用小数点来表示。例如,上海的经度可以表示为121.4811111。

3. 度分秒和十进制小数点的转换

将度分秒转换成十进制小数点的公式为:

十进制小数点 = 度 + 分/60 + 秒/3600

例如,将E121°28'52"转换成十进制小数点,可以使用以下公式:

121 + 28/60 + 52/3600 = 121.4811111

二、批量转换经纬度度分秒

在excel中,我们可以使用以下方法批量将经纬度度分秒转换成十进制小数点。

1. 创建一个新的工作表

首先,我们需要创建一个新的工作表,用于存储转换后的经纬度数据。

2. 导入经纬度数据

将需要转换的经纬度数据导入到新的工作表中。确保经度和纬度分别位于不同的列中。

3. 添加公式

在新的工作表中添加公式,将经纬度度分秒转换成十进制小数点。例如,对于经度,可以使用以下公式:

=IF(A2<>"",IF(LEFT(A2,1)="W",-1,1)*(ABS(LEFT(A2,LEN(A2)-1))+MID(A2,SEARCH("°",A2)+1,LEN(A2)-SEARCH("°",A2)-1)/60+RIGHT(A2,LEN(A2)-SEARCH("'",A2)-1)/3600),"")

这个公式可以将A2单元格中的经度度分秒转换成十进制小数点。如果A2单元格为空,则返回空字符串。

4. 拖动公式

将公式拖动到整个列中,以便批量转换经纬度度分秒。

5. 格式化数据

将转换后的经纬度数据格式化为十进制小数点,以便后续的计算和分析。

三、注意事项

在批量转换经纬度度分秒时,需要注意以下几点。

1. 数据格式

确保导入的经纬度数据格式正确,例如,经度应该以E或W开头,纬度应该以N或S开头。

2. 公式的正确性

在添加公式时,需要确保公式的正确性。可以使用单元格引用和函数来避免错误。

3. 数据的准确性

转换后的经纬度数据可能存在一定的误差,特别是在高精度计算时。在进行计算和分析时,需要注意数据的准确性。

四、

5天短视频训练营
新手入门剪辑课程,零基础也能学
分享变现渠道,助你兼职赚钱
限时特惠:0元
立即抢
新手剪辑课程 (精心挑选,简单易学)
第一课
新手如何学剪辑视频? 开始学习
第二课
短视频剪辑培训班速成是真的吗? 开始学习
第三课
不需要付费的视频剪辑软件有哪些? 开始学习
第四课
手机剪辑app哪个好? 开始学习
第五课
如何做短视频剪辑赚钱? 开始学习
第六课
视频剪辑接单网站APP有哪些? 开始学习
第七课
哪里可以学短视频运营? 开始学习
第八课
做短视频运营需要会什么? 开始学习
相关问题
excel怎么计算标准差?
excel表格曲线图怎么和表格数据绑定?
excel表格网格线怎么取消?
Excel中表格文字自动换行的操作方法?
查看更多

客服热线:0731-85127885

湘ICP备19005950号-1  

工商营业执照信息

违法和不良信息举报

举报电话:0731-85127885 举报邮箱:tousu@csai.cn

优草派  版权所有 © 2024